Daniel Craig
Daniel Wroughton Craig (born 2 March 1968) is an English actor. After training at the National Youth Theatre and graduating from the Guildhall School of Music and Drama in 1991, Craig began his career on stage. He made his film debut in the drama The Power of One (1992) and attracted attention with appearances in the historical television war drama Sharpe's Eagle (1993), the family film A Kid in King Arthur's Court (1995), the television serial drama Our Friends in the North (1996), the biographical film Elizabeth (1998), the television film Love Is the Devil: Study for a Portrait of Francis Bacon (1998), the indie war film The Trench (1999), the drama film Some Voices (2000), the action film Lara Croft: Tomb Raider (2001), the crime thriller film Road to Perdition (2002), the crime thriller film Layer Cake (2004), and the historical drama film Munich (2005).

WARNING: SPOILERS AHEAD FOR NO TIME TO DIE. The latest James Bond introduced a number of new characters along with some familiar faces.

One of the first-timers was Billy Magnussen's Logan Ash, a fellow CIA agent alongside Jeffrey Wright's Felix Leiter. The double agent was working for Rami Malek's Safin all along before meeting his end at the hands of Bond and now Billy has shared how ecstatic he was to be cast in the 007 movie.

Billy told Express. co. uk said: "God bless Cary Fukunaga for daring to put me in this film and I thank him for it. "Asked if he enjoyed Craig's Bond calling his character "the blonde" and "Book of Mormon" in No Time To Die, the 36-year-old said: "I loved it!"That's exactly what we were going for.
